app/models/c80_estate/sevent.rb in c80_estate-0.1.0.24 vs app/models/c80_estate/sevent.rb in c80_estate-0.1.0.25
- old
+ new
@@ -91,11 +91,11 @@
summ += a[:ecoef]
end
result[:average_value] = sprintf "%.2f%", summ/k*100
result[:comment] = "<abbr title='Период рассчёта эффективности: с момента самого первого известного события до текущего дня'>C #{Time.at(self.first.created_at).strftime('%Y/%m/%d')} по #{Time.now.year}/#{sprintf "%02d", Time.now.month}/#{sprintf "%02d", Time.now.day}</abbr>"
- result[:abbr] = 'Среднее значение для всех площадей за весь период'
+ result[:abbr] = 'Среднее значение коэф-та эффективности для всех площадей за весь период. Эффективность - это число b/N, где b - кол-во дней которые площадь была занята (за указанный период), N - всего дней в указанном периоде'
result[:title] = 'Статистика - Все площади'
result[:props] = [
{tag:'all_areas_count', val: "Площадей всего: #{Area.all.count}"},
{tag:'free_areas_count', val: "Площадей свободно: #{Area.free_areas.count}"},
{tag:'busy_areas_count', val: "Площадей занято: #{Area.busy_areas.count}"}
@@ -183,23 +183,23 @@
sevents: sevents
}
result[:average_value] = sprintf "%.2f%", result[area_id][:ecoef]*100
result[:comment] = "<abbr title='Период рассчёта коэф-та эффективности'>C #{used_start_date_str} по #{used_end_date_str}</abbr>"
- result[:abbr] = 'Коэф-т эффективности площади за указанный период'
- result[:title] = "Статистика - #{area.title}"
+ result[:abbr] = 'Коэф-т эффективности площади за указанный период. Эффективность - это число b/N, где b - кол-во дней которые площадь была занята (за указанный период), N - всего дней в указанном периоде'
+ result[:title] = "Статистика - площадь '#{area.title}'"
result[:graph] = _parse_for_js_graph(sevents)
if mark_whole
if t[:time_busy] == 0
t[:time_free] = used_end_date - used_start_date
end
end
result[:props] = [
- { tag: 'title', val: "#{area.title}" },
+ { tag: 'title', val: "Площадь: #{area.title}" },
{ tag: 'atype', val: "Тип: #{area.atype_title}" },
- # { tag: 'born_date', val: "Дата создания: #{area.created_at.in_time_zone('Moscow')}" },
+ { tag: 'born_date', val: "Дата создания: #{area.created_at.in_time_zone('Moscow').strftime('%Y/%m/%d')}" },
{ tag: 'busy_time', val: "<abbr title='В указанный период'>Времени занята</abbr>: #{time_duration(t[:time_busy])}" },
{ tag: 'free_time', val: "<abbr title='В указанный период'>Времени свободна</abbr>: #{time_duration(t[:time_free])}" },
{ tag: 'all_time', val: "<abbr title='В указанный период'>Времени всего</abbr>: #{time_duration(t[:time_busy] + t[:time_free])}" },
{ tag: 'assigned_person_title', val: "Ответственный: #{area.assigned_person_title}" },
{ tag: 'property_title', val: "Объект: #{area.property_title}" }
\ No newline at end of file